debian如何安装c编译器(debian安装cinnamon)
如何在Linux系统中编译一个开源软件项目并自定义安装路径?
1、准备编译环境确保系统已安装基础编译工具和依赖管理工具:C/C++编译器:gcc 或 clang。构建工具:make、autoconf/automake(若项目使用Autotools)、cmake(若项目使用CMake)。依赖管理:pkg-config(用于查找库路径)。

2、路径自定义:通过--prefix或CMAKE_INSTALL_PREFIX指定安装路径,避免污染系统目录。依赖管理:复杂项目可能依赖第三方库,需仔细阅读文档安装所有依赖。掌握上述流程后,可灵活部署大多数开源工具。核心步骤为克隆代码→安装依赖→配置编译→安装部署,结合项目文档调整细节即可。
3、在Linux环境下安装软件时,通常会用到三个命令:./configure、make、make install。这三个命令共同完成软件的配置、编译和安装过程。./configure:该命令用于配置构建环境,检测系统特性,如是否存在编译器,以及根据系统参数生成定制化的Makefile。
4、安装编译程序因为要编译源代码,所以第一步就是安装编译和构建之类的程序。如果你已经安装过了,可以跳过此步。在Ubuntu系统中非常简单,只要执行下面命令就行了: $ sudo apt-get install build-essential 该命令执行后,从源文件安装软件所需的工具,如gcc、make、g++及其他所需软件就安装好了。
如何安装最新版本的GCC?Linux源码编译与更新步骤
1、步骤一:检查当前GCC版本打开终端,输入以下命令查看已安装的GCC版本:gcc --version输出示例:gcc (Ubuntu 0-1ubuntu1~04) 0记录当前版本号,以便后续对比。
2、安装 GCC 编译器GCC 是 Linux 默认的 C++ 编译器,支持多种语言和标准。
3、具体升级步骤如下:首先,检查当前系统中gcc的版本,并确认是否需要更新。然后,根据发行版的特点,下载合适的gcc版本。在一些发行版中,可以通过官方软件仓库直接获取更新,而在其他情况下,可能需要从gcc的官方网站下载源代码进行编译安装。

4、在Linux系统上安装GCC编译器可通过包管理器快速完成,核心步骤包括选择对应发行版的安装命令、验证安装结果,并需理解常见问题排查与多版本管理方法。
5、在Linux环境中,遇到gcc版本不支持所需C++标准的情况时,传统的方法如源码编译或系统升级可能会带来风险。一个更为安全且官方推荐的解决方案是使用Red Hat的Devtoolset。Devtoolset是一个工具集,旨在让旧版Linux系统运行最新的编译器,如GCC,从而满足开发需求,促进团队协作。
6、在Linux下编译和运行C程序需要安装编译器,通常是gcc或cc。以下是具体步骤:安装gcc编译器:在Linux系统下,首先需要确保安装了gcc编译器。如果没有安装,可以通过包管理器进行安装,例如在Debian/Ubuntu系统上可以使用sudo aptget install gcc命令。
Linux下如何编译,运行C程序?需要安装编译器吗
在Linux下编译和运行C程序需要安装编译器,通常是gcc或cc。以下是具体步骤:安装gcc编译器:在Linux系统下,首先需要确保安装了gcc编译器。如果没有安装,可以通过包管理器进行安装,例如在Debian/Ubuntu系统上可以使用sudo aptget install gcc命令。编辑C源文件:使用文本编辑器创建一个后缀名为.c的C源文件。
首先一定要安装 gcc (或者 cc )编译器。然后在 Linux 系统下,首先使用 vi 全屏幕编辑程序编辑一个后缀名为 .c 的文件,然后使用 gcc 编译器对你的 C 语言源程序进行编译、连接。最后才能够运行生成后的运行文件(如果你的源程序没有任何编译错误的话)。
安装GCC:GCC是Linux环境下常用的C语言编译器。通过终端运行命令sudo apt update && sudo apt install build-essential来安装GCC,这是编译C语言代码所必需的。

GCC是Linux下常用的C语言编译器。可以通过终端输入sudo aptget install gcc或sudo yum install gcc来安装GCC。创建C源文件:使用文本编辑器创建一个后缀名为.c的文件。例如,使用vim创建文件:vim c.c。编写C代码:在创建的文件中编写C语言代码,确保包含必要的头文件和main函数。
Python安装Pyarrow失败:cmake错误如何解决?
安装Pyarrow时出现cmake错误,通常是因为系统缺少cmake或其路径未配置,可通过安装和配置cmake、更新pip后重新安装Pyarrow解决。 具体步骤如下:安装cmake:根据操作系统选择合适的安装方法。
出现“cmake: command not found”错误是因为系统缺少CMake编译工具,解决方法是安装CMake并根据系统选择对应安装方式,安装后重新安装Pyarrow,若问题仍存在需检查环境变量、权限和网络连接。
debian10系统原本为64位系统,如何配置32位编译、运行环境
安装32位编译环境 安装gccmultilib:执行命令 sudo aptget install gccmultilib 以安装支持32位编译的GCC编译器。这将确保你可以编译32位的C程序。安装g++multilib:执行命令 sudo aptget install g++multilib 以安装支持32位编译的G++编译器。这将确保你可以编译32位的C++程序。
通用方案(以Ubuntu/Debian为例)启用32位架构:执行sudo dpkg --add-architecture i386 && sudo apt update。安装Wine32组件:运行sudo apt install wine32。初始化32位环境:执行WINEARCH=win32 wineboot --init,此命令会创建32位Wine前缀,用于运行32位Windows应用。
通过Wine运行Notepad++(需兼容性调试)安装Wine环境 更新软件包列表并安装Wine及32位支持库(部分旧版Notepad++需32位环境):sudo apt updatesudo apt install wine wine32 验证安装:运行 wine --version 确认版本信息。下载并安装Notepad++ 从官方网站下载Windows版安装包(如.exe文件)。
硬件评估:精准匹配系统要求CPU架构 确认处理器为32位(x86)或64位(x86_64)。多数轻量系统仍支持32位,但新版本逐渐淘汰,若硬件过老(如Pentium III),需选择兼容旧架构的系统(如AntiX)。
上一篇:debian发行版是如何构建的(debian发布周期)
栏 目:Debian
下一篇:debian如何wifi驱动(debian安装网卡驱动教程)
本文标题:debian如何安装c编译器(debian安装cinnamon)
本文地址:https://www.fushidao.cc/server/52396.html
您可能感兴趣的文章
- 02-26Debian升级glibc至2.32,内核版本升级过程中有何挑战与解决方法?
- 02-26debian如何下载(debian完整版怎么安装)
- 02-26debian5系统如何设置路由(debian添加默认路由)
- 02-26Debian 10升级至最新版xfce4,安装xfce4的方法是什么?
- 02-26Debian系统如何高效配置Yum源,实现源更新?
- 02-26debian如何扩大一个分区(debian手动分区教程)
- 02-26在debian系统中,如何高效查找和查看特定目录或文件?
- 02-25如何设置Debian系统开机不启动桌面环境,仅运行命令行界面?
- 02-25debian如何安装tar软件(debian安装transmission)
- 02-25Debian系统如何成功配置和使用Miracast无线投影功能?
阅读排行
- 1Debian升级glibc至2.32,内核版本升级过程中有何挑战与解决方法?
- 2debian如何下载(debian完整版怎么安装)
- 3debian5系统如何设置路由(debian添加默认路由)
- 4Debian 10升级至最新版xfce4,安装xfce4的方法是什么?
- 5Debian系统如何高效配置Yum源,实现源更新?
- 6debian如何扩大一个分区(debian手动分区教程)
- 7在debian系统中,如何高效查找和查看特定目录或文件?
- 8如何设置Debian系统开机不启动桌面环境,仅运行命令行界面?
- 9debian如何安装tar软件(debian安装transmission)
- 10Debian系统如何成功配置和使用Miracast无线投影功能?
推荐教程
- 02-01Debian系统怎么安装硬件驱动?详细步骤与常见问题解决方案 Debian系统怎么安装硬件
- 01-27如何轻松实现Debian系统下WiFi驱动安装与配置?
- 02-05debian系统如何修改语言(debian系统语言更改)
- 01-24如何高效分区 Debian 系统?详细步骤与最佳实践揭秘!
- 02-19在Debian上安装Node.js和SSH,有何高效步骤可遵循?
- 02-10debian如何查看网络参数(debian查看网口速率)
- 02-06debian如何设置开机启动程序(debian10开机启动)
- 02-05debian中如何查看服务(debian查看系统配置)
- 02-03Debian中查看特定服务状态或配置,有哪几种高效方法可用?
- 02-16在Ubuntu系统上修改为Debian源的具体步骤和注意事项是什么?
